Output 881b900dd58daacacf105a9e2225a3fb816ccfb03cd12c5bc0cc3d9358004b07:2

value
51297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 131f3012f039798491fcb32b385599f0d83f84d9 OP_EQUAL
address
33S889teHgNjHYYoHs1hTSHWUUEGGDqKzi
transaction
881b900dd58daacacf105a9e2225a3fb816ccfb03cd12c5bc0cc3d9358004b07
spent
true